Transaction 58a3a998c832beb0cf94bc56a3c9230abae2818ed905ae4738636af31be63062
1 Input
1 Output
-
58a3a998c832beb0cf94bc56a3c9230abae2818ed905ae4738636af31be63062:0
- value
- 358378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b319507b96ec976352a02d06eb4a2d447595542 OP_EQUAL
- address
- 3761BtZktFbMpJNhSQ8wAaGqcHMAJdKKsd